SHIZEN (signed)
by Toru Morimoto
Photographs: Toru Morimoto
Text: Matilde Vittoria Laricchia, English translations Massimiliano Barachini
Publisher: Origini edizioni
36 pages
Pictures: 15 b/w
Year: 2020
Price: 350 €
Comments: 150 copies numbered and signed (trade edition 130 copies numbered and signed by the author) 45 x 24cm alternation of different papers: gold tissue paper, parchment style paper semi-transparent, transparent white paper Thieberge & Comar 90 gr, Ivory Cambridge Library Pigna 60 gr. Binding: Machine sewn in black 1 essay text + English translation The book is spread out on a Finnish wood fiber cardboard and all is wrapped in Ivory tissue paper.
Once again we go back to the East, to Japan. This time our research leads us to deepen the relationships of this culture with Nature: relationships that seem ambivalent and contradictory to us. It is adored, mythologized and at the same time sacrificed and violated to the needs of the user and cementing. SHIZEN (Nature) is a book that remains suspended between the branches of its veils, its light papers, traditional and fleeting panoramas that run between the fingers of the reader like a silk thread.
